Importance of Analytical Techniques in Pharmaceuticals
Analytical techniques play a pivotal role in the development, quality control, and regulatory compliance of pharmaceutical products. These techniques ensure the safety, efficacy, and consistency of drugs by accurately identifying and quantifying active pharmaceutical ingredients (APIs) and impurities. Modern analytical methods, such as High-Performance Liquid Chromatography (HPLC), Gas Chromatography (GC), Mass Spectrometry (MS), and Spectroscopy, are widely used in the pharmaceutical industry.
Key Topics Covered in MAT101T
- Chromatographic Techniques: HPLC, GC, Thin Layer Chromatography (TLC), and their applications in drug analysis.
- Spectroscopic Methods: UV-Visible Spectroscopy, Infrared Spectroscopy (IR), Nuclear Magnetic Resonance (NMR), and their use in structural elucidation.
- Electrochemical Methods: Potentiometry, Conductometry, and their role in pharmaceutical analysis.
- Thermal Analysis: Differential Scanning Calorimetry (DSC) and Thermogravimetric Analysis (TGA) for studying drug stability.
- Validation of Analytical Methods: Understanding the principles of method validation as per regulatory guidelines.
